In the modern 3D production pipeline, security is not just a concern—it is a necessity. As malicious scripts and malicious plugins become more sophisticated, Autodesk has enhanced the security posture of Maya, specifically targeting the initialization process. One of the most critical, and sometimes confusing, aspects of this is the prompt, which often appears regarding the userSetup.py or userSetup.mel files. maya secure user setup checksum verification exclusive

As Autodesk Maya becomes increasingly integral to high-stakes 3D animation and VFX pipelines, security has become a critical concern. Malicious scripts and malware, such as the infamous "vaccine" virus, can compromise production environments, causing data loss, production delays, and corrupted files.
